Oregon Arts Watch

Oregon ArtsWatch is an arts and culture project founded by culture reporter Barry Johnson in Portland. He aimed to make the site a collaboration with Portland-area performing arts groups. Johnson has written and edited arts and culture stories since 1978. He started ArtsWatch after he left The Oregonian, where he worked for 26 years. He also contributes arts coverage to Oregon Public Broadcasting.
